Subject: [bug#66730] [PATCH core-updates] gnu: gcc@11: Update to 11.4.0.
Date: Tue, 24 Oct 2023 15:29:27 +0000	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20231024152950.71342-1-code@greghogan.com> (raw)

* gnu/packages/gcc.scm (gcc-11): Update to 11.4.0.
Remove ‘gcc-10-tree-sra-union-handling.patch’.
* gnu/local.mk: Delist patch.
* gnu/packages/patches/gcc-10-tree-sra-union-handling.patch: Delete.
---
 gnu/local.mk                                  |  1 -
 gnu/packages/gcc.scm                          |  7 ++--
 .../gcc-10-tree-sra-union-handling.patch      | 33 -------------------
 3 files changed, 3 insertions(+), 38 deletions(-)
 delete mode 100644 gnu/packages/patches/gcc-10-tree-sra-union-handling.patch

diff --git a/gnu/packages/gcc.scm b/gnu/packages/gcc.scm
index 621644b93f..f50cd0969e 100644
--- a/gnu/packages/gcc.scm
+++ b/gnu/packages/gcc.scm
@@ -728,17 +728,16 @@ (define-public gcc-10
 (define-public gcc-11
   (package
    (inherit gcc-8)
-   (version "11.3.0")
+   (version "11.4.0")
    (source (origin
             (method url-fetch)
             (uri (string-append "mirror://gnu/gcc/gcc-"
                                 version "/gcc-" version ".tar.xz"))
             (sha256
              (base32
-              "0fdclcwf728wbq52vphfcjywzhpsjp3kifzj3pib3xcihs0z4z5l"))
+              "1ncd7akww0hl5kkmw1dj3qgqp3phdrr5dfnm7jia9s07n0ib4b9z"))
             (patches (search-patches "gcc-9-strmov-store-file-names.patch"
-                                     "gcc-5.0-libvtv-runpath.patch"
-                                     "gcc-10-tree-sra-union-handling.patch"))
+                                     "gcc-5.0-libvtv-runpath.patch"))
             (modules '((guix build utils)))
             (snippet gcc-canadian-cross-objdump-snippet)))
    (arguments
diff --git a/gnu/packages/patches/gcc-10-tree-sra-union-handling.patch b/gnu/packages/patches/gcc-10-tree-sra-union-handling.patch
deleted file mode 100644
index aae5fc9f72..0000000000
--- a/gnu/packages/patches/gcc-10-tree-sra-union-handling.patch
+++ /dev/null
@@ -1,33 +0,0 @@
-Fix a regression in GCC 10/11/12 where some union structures
-could get miscompiled when optimizations are enabled:
-
-  https://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=105860
-
-Taken from upstream:
-
-  https://gcc.gnu.org/g:16afe2e2862f3dd93c711d7f8d436dee23c6c34d
-
-diff --git a/gcc/tree-sra.c b/gcc/tree-sra.c
-index 09d951a261b..420329f63f6 100644
---- a/gcc/tree-sra.c
-+++ b/gcc/tree-sra.c
-@@ -1647,7 +1647,18 @@ build_ref_for_offset (location_t loc, tree base, poly_int64 offset,
- static tree
- build_reconstructed_reference (location_t, tree base, struct access *model)
- {
--  tree expr = model->expr, prev_expr = NULL;
-+  tree expr = model->expr;
-+  /* We have to make sure to start just below the outermost union.  */
-+  tree start_expr = expr;
-+  while (handled_component_p (expr))
-+    {
-+      if (TREE_CODE (TREE_TYPE (TREE_OPERAND (expr, 0))) == UNION_TYPE)
-+	start_expr = expr;
-+      expr = TREE_OPERAND (expr, 0);
-+    }
-+
-+  expr = start_expr;
-+  tree prev_expr = NULL_TREE;
-   while (!types_compatible_p (TREE_TYPE (expr), TREE_TYPE (base)))
-     {
-       if (!handled_component_p (expr))
--
